Impact of Particle Size Distribution of Colloidal Particles on Contaminant Transport in Porous Media
Abstract
The presence of retained colloidal particles causes the retardation of contaminant transport when the contaminant is favorably adsorbed to colloidal particles. Although the particle size distribution affects the retention behavior of colloidal particles, the impact of particle size distribution on contaminant transport has not been reported to date.
